Package org.neo4j.cypherdsl.core
Interface StatementBuilder.ExposesOrderBy
-
- All Known Subinterfaces:
StatementBuilder.OrderableOngoingReadingAndWith
,StatementBuilder.OrderableOngoingReadingAndWithWithoutWhere
,StatementBuilder.OrderableOngoingReadingAndWithWithWhere
- Enclosing interface:
- StatementBuilder
public static interface StatementBuilder.ExposesOrderBy
SeeStatementBuilder.TerminalExposesOrderBy
, but on a with clause.- Since:
- 1.0
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description StatementBuilder.OngoingOrderDefinition
orderBy(Expression expression)
Order the result set by an expression.StatementBuilder.OrderableOngoingReadingAndWithWithWhere
orderBy(SortItem... sortItem)
Order the result set by one or moresort items
.
-
-
-
Method Detail
-
orderBy
StatementBuilder.OrderableOngoingReadingAndWithWithWhere orderBy(SortItem... sortItem)
Order the result set by one or moresort items
. Those can be retrieved for all expression withCypher.sort(Expression)
or directly from properties.- Parameters:
sortItem
- One or more sort items- Returns:
- A build step that still offers methods for defining skip and limit
-
orderBy
StatementBuilder.OngoingOrderDefinition orderBy(Expression expression)
Order the result set by an expression.- Parameters:
expression
- The expression to order by- Returns:
- A step that allows for adding more expression or fine-tuning the sort direction of the last expression
-
-